Skip to main content

Intent Recognition in a Simulated Maritime Multi-agent Domain

  • Conference paper
  • First Online:
Machine Learning, Optimization, and Big Data (MOD 2015)

Part of the book series: Lecture Notes in Computer Science ((LNISA,volume 9432))

Included in the following conference series:

  • 2187 Accesses

Abstract

Intent recognition is the process of determining the action an agent is about to take, given a sequence of past actions. In this paper, we propose a method for recognizing intentions in highly populated multi-agent environments. Low-level intentions, representing basic activities, are detected through a novel formulation of Hidden Markov Models with perspective-taking capabilities. Higher level intentions, involving multiple agents, are detected with a distributed architecture that uses activation spreading between nodes to detect the most likely intention of the agents. The solution we propose brings the following main contributions: (i) it enables early recognition of intentions before they are being realized, (ii) it has real-time performance capabilities, and (iii) it can detect both single agent as well as joint intentions of a group of agents. We validate our framework in an open source naval ship simulator, the context of recognizing threatening intentions against naval ships. Our results show that our system is able to detect intentions early and with high accuracy.

This work has been supported by the Office of Naval Research, under grant number N00014-09-1-1121.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 39.99
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

References

  1. Kautz, H.A., Allen, J.F.: Generalized plan recognition. AAAI 86, 32–37 (1986)

    Google Scholar 

  2. Geib, C.W., Goldman, R.P.: A probabilistic plan recognition algorithm based on plan tree grammars. Artif. Intell. 173(11), 1101–1132 (2009)

    Article  MathSciNet  Google Scholar 

  3. Levine, S.J., Williams, B.C.: Concurrent plan recognition and execution for human-robot teams. In: Twenty-Fourth International Conference on Automated Planning and Scheduling (2014)

    Google Scholar 

  4. Zhuo, H.H., Li, L.: Multi-agent plan recognition with partial team traces and plan libraries. IJCAI 22(1), 484 (2011)

    MathSciNet  Google Scholar 

  5. Zhuo, H.H., Yang, Q., Kambhampati, S.: Action-model based multi-agent plan recognition. In: Advances in Neural Information Processing Systems, pp. 368–376 (2012)

    Google Scholar 

  6. Luebke, D.: CUDA: Scalable parallel programming for high-performance scientific computing. In: 5th IEEE International Symposium on Biomedical Imaging: From Nano to Macro, ISBI 2008, pp. 836–838 (2008)

    Google Scholar 

  7. Demiris, Y.: Prediction of intent in robotics and multi-agent systems. Cogn. Process. 8(3), 151–158 (2007)

    Article  Google Scholar 

  8. Kelley, R., King, C., Tavakkoli, A., Nicolescu, M., Nicolescu, M., Bebis, G.: An architecture for understanding intent using a novel hidden markov formulation. Int. J. Humanoid Robot. 5(2), 203–224 (2008)

    Article  Google Scholar 

  9. Kelley, R., Tavakkoli, A., King, C., Nicolescu, M., Nicolescu, M., Bebis, G.: Understanding human intentions via hidden markov models in autonomous mobile robots. In: The 3rd ACM/IEEE international conference on Human robot interaction, pp. 367–374 (2008)

    Google Scholar 

  10. Banerjee, B., Kraemer, L., Lyle, J.: Multi-agent plan recognition: formalization and algorithms. In: AAAI (2010)

    Google Scholar 

  11. Azarewicz, J., Fala, G., Heithecker, C.: Template-based multi-agent plan recognition for tactical situation assessment. In: Artificial Intelligence Applications, pp. 247–254 (1989)

    Google Scholar 

  12. Erlhagen, W., Mukovskiy, A., Bicho, E.: A dynamic model for action understanding and goal-directed imitation. Brain Res. 1083(1), 174–188 (2006)

    Article  Google Scholar 

  13. Hayes, B., Scassellati, B.: Discovering task constraints through observation and active learning. In: IROS (2014)

    Google Scholar 

  14. Wilson, H.R., Cowan, J.D.: A mathematical theory of the functional dynamics of cortical and thalamic nervous tissue. Kybernetik 13(2), 55–80 (1973)

    Article  MATH  Google Scholar 

  15. Amari, S.: Dynamics of pattern formation in lateral-inhibition type neural fields. Biol. Cybern. 27(2), 77–87 (1977)

    Article  MATH  MathSciNet  Google Scholar 

  16. Nicolescu, M., Leigh, R., Olenderski, A., Louis, S., Dascalu, S., Miles, C., Quiroz, J., Aleson, R.: A training simulation system with realistic autonomous ship control. Comput. Intell. 23(4), 497–516 (2007)

    Article  MathSciNet  Google Scholar 

  17. Quigley, M., Conley, K., Gerkey, B., Faust, J., Foote, T., Leibs, J., Wheeler, R., Ng, A.Y.: ROS: an open-source robot operating system. In: ICRA Workshop on Open Source Software (2009)

    Google Scholar 

  18. Baum, L.E., Petrie, T., Soules, G., Weiss, N.: A maximization technique occurring in the statistical analysis of probabilistic functions of Markov chains. Ann. Math. Stat. 41, 164–171 (1970)

    Article  MATH  MathSciNet  Google Scholar 

  19. Rabiner, L.: A tutorial on hidden Markov models and selected applications in speech recognition. Proc. IEEE 77(2), 257–286 (1989)

    Article  Google Scholar 

  20. Liu, C.: cuHMM: a CUDA Implementation of Hidden Markov Model Training and Classification. Johns Hopkins University, Baltimore (2009)

    Google Scholar 

  21. Nguyen, N.T., Phung, D.Q., Venkatesh, S., Bui, H.: Learning and detecting activities from movement trajectories using the hierarchical hidden Markov model. In: CVPR, pp. 955–960 (2005)

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Mohammad Taghi Saffar .

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2015 Springer International Publishing Switzerland

About this paper

Cite this paper

Saffar, M.T., Nicolescu, M., Nicolescu, M., Bigelow, D., Ballinger, C., Louis, S. (2015). Intent Recognition in a Simulated Maritime Multi-agent Domain. In: Pardalos, P., Pavone, M., Farinella, G., Cutello, V. (eds) Machine Learning, Optimization, and Big Data. MOD 2015. Lecture Notes in Computer Science(), vol 9432. Springer, Cham. https://doi.org/10.1007/978-3-319-27926-8_14

Download citation

  • DOI: https://doi.org/10.1007/978-3-319-27926-8_14

  • Published:

  • Publisher Name: Springer, Cham

  • Print ISBN: 978-3-319-27925-1

  • Online ISBN: 978-3-319-27926-8

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ics